#d8802e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d8802e is composed of 84.7% red, 50.2%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.7% magenta, 78.7%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 28.9 degrees, a saturation of 68.5% and a lightness of 51.4%. #d8802e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5c with #b10100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

● #d8802e color description : Strong orange.
#d8802e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d8802e has RGB values of R:216, G:128,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.79,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14188590.
